Have nothing in your home that you don't know to be useful or believe to be beautiful William Morris c1840 Gorgeous Coalport Porcelain Rococo Revival Coffee Can Duo - dainty pattern of gold squiggles, fronds, scrolls loop handle finished with gilt rim on white ground. Not stamped but the pattern number is on the base 4/955 Coalport was one of the leading Potters of iconic designs in the 19th & 20th century. The Pottery emerged around the 1800 in Shropshire right on the outskirts of Staffordshire where other leading Potteries such as Minton, Spode, Davenport & many others began. Founded by John Rose who had been apprenticed to Thomas Turner of Caughley. Considering the age, the duo is in excellent antique condition. Some minor loss on the gilt trim & some marks inside the can. Please study the photos carefully. The dimensions are 5 7/8 wide for the saucer, 2 7/8 tall & wide for the coffee can.
